Tragic Car Accident in Aragatsotn Province: 4 Minors Have Died, One in Critical Condition
On March 14, a major and tragic car accident occurred in Aragatsotn Province, reports Shamshyan.com.
At around 19:40, an Opel vehicle traveling on the Yerevan-Gyumri highway at the 67 km mark, heading towards Talin, veered into the oncoming lane, uprooted a tree, collided with several rocks, and ended up rolling over multiple times in a field.
As a result of the accident, five individuals were urgently transported to the Talin Medical Center with extremely serious injuries, thanks to the efforts of doctors from Talin Hospital and passing citizens; three of them later succumbed to their injuries.
While attempts were being made to investigate the accident site, the Talin police department received a report from the hospital indicating that four of the injured had died.
The police and investigative unit are currently working to determine the identities of the deceased, the driver, and the injured.
An operational group, led by the head of the Talin police department, has also arrived promptly on the scene. According to photojournalist reports, the deceased victims are minors.
